Description

They helped invent the bar code. They revolutionized business schools and created the corporate practices that now rule our world.

They reinvented the idea of American capitalism and aggressively exported it across the globe.

McKinsey employees are trusted and distrusted, loved and despised.

They are doing behind-the-scenes work for the most powerful people in the world, and their ranks of alumni include the chairman of HSBC and William Hague. Renowned financial journalist Duff McDonald uncovers how these high-priced business savants have ushered in waves of structural, financial, and technological shifts but also become mired in controversy across the years.

Discover how the firm both endorsed and celebrated Enron’s disastrous corporate structure and how they’ve been instrumental in the Coalition’s controversial NHS reforms.

Are they worth their astronomical fees? And what do firms and governments actually get for their money?

Based on exclusive interviews with key McKinsey players and written in gripping prose, this is a revealing window onto one of the most secretive and powerful companies in the world.
